Yes, you can use multiple XFX graphics cards in SLI or CrossFire configurations, depending on the specific models of the cards you are using. SLI, which is NVIDIA's technology, can be utilized with compatible XFX GeForce graphics cards. CrossFire is the equivalent technology from AMD and can be used with compatible XFX Radeon graphics cards. In both cases, it is essential to ensure that the motherboards being used support either SLI or CrossFire and are configured correctly to harness the power of multiple graphics cards.
When setting up multiple graphics cards, it is also important to check that your power supply can handle the additional power requirements and that proper cooling is in place to manage the increased heat generated. Furthermore, both SLI and CrossFire can deliver significant performance improvements in certain gaming scenarios, but not all games benefit equally from these technologies.
